Micro-coherence network strength and deep behavior modification optimization application
A subject's Default Mode Network is accessed through corresponding measurements of the Micro-Coherence Oximetry Network Strength (MCO-S). An associated MCO-S system (100) includes a wearable (102), a user device (112) and a processing platform (123). The wearable (102) collects subject information sufficient to enable monitoring and optimization of the subject's Default Mode Network include sensors such as pulse oximetry instrumentation and EEG electrodes to obtain brainwave data, oxygen saturation data, heart rate variability data, and galvanic skin conductance data. Information from the sensors may be communicated to a user device (112), such as a cell phone or VR headset. The user device (112) communicates with a remote processing platform (123) that may execute artificial intelligence functionality and other logic in connection with assessing the patient's micro-coherence network strength and optimizing behavior modification protocols in relation to attributes and objectives of the subject.
INHALATION OF NITRIC OXIDE
A method of treating a human subject which is effected by inhalation of gaseous nitric oxide, the method comprising a first treatment period comprising administering gNO by inhalation over a period of about at least 5 days, wherein the first treatment period is followed by a second treatment period comprising administering gNO by inhalation over a period of at least 3 months. The method can be utilized for treating a human subject suffering from, or prone to suffer from, a disease or disorder that is manifested in the respiratory tract, or from a disease or disorder that can be treated via the respiratory tract.
S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R DETECTION AND PREVENTION OF EMERGENCE OF AGITATION
Disclosed in the present disclosure is a method, system and apparatus for prediction, estimation and prevention of occurrence of agitation episode in a subject predisposed to agitation. The method comprises receiving, from a first monitoring device attached to a subject, physiological data of sympathetic nervous system activity in the subject and activity data of the subject; receiving, from a computing device, a plurality of indications associated with a plurality of agitation episodes of the subject; analyzing, using at least one machine learning model, the physiological data, the activity data, and the plurality of indications to determine a probability of an occurrence of an agitation episode of the subject; and sending a signal to a second monitoring device to notify the second monitoring device of the probability of the occurrence of the agitation episode of the subject such that treatment can be provided to the subject to decrease sympathetic nervous system activity in the subject.
HIGH DESIGN ASSURANCE LOW COST MULTI-MODAL PILOT SAFETY SYSTEMS
A pilot-monitoring safety system is disclosed. The system comprises a head worn display including one or more heart rate sensors configured to generate heart rate measurements of a user of the head worn display, and one or more eye trackers configured to generate eye-gaze measurements of the user of the head worn display. The system further comprises a pilot-monitoring computing device configured to determine a health state of the user based on at least the heart rate measurements and the eye-gaze measurements, and responsive to the health state indicating a dangerous condition of the user, present an alert to the user using the head worn display. The system further comprises an autopilot computing device configured to, responsive to a predetermined time period elapsing without a response to the visual alert from the user, automatically control an aircraft.

System and method for controlling an interior environmental condition in a vehicle
A system and method are described for controlling a vehicle interior environmental condition. A biometric sensor senses a biometric condition of a vehicle seat occupant and generates a sensed biometric condition value. A controller receives the sensed biometric condition value, a sensed interior environmental condition value, and a sensed exterior environmental condition value. Each of multiple exterior environmental condition values has an associated biometric condition value defined as optimal for the vehicle occupant. The controller determines the optimal biometric condition value associated with the sensed exterior environmental condition value, compares the optimal biometric condition value to the sensed biometric condition value, and in response to a difference between the optimal biometric condition value and the sensed biometric condition value, generates a control signal to control an actuator to control the controllable interior environmental condition to reduce the difference between sensed biometric condition value and the optimal biometric condition value.

Wearable device to identify medical emergencies and notify
An electronic battery-operated medical bracelet device that contains the technology to accurately detect collapse/fall or other medical emergencies, through the monitoring of the heart rate, oxygen saturation, heart rhythm, and patient input. The bracelet will also display the vital readings to the user if the readings return as abnormal, in an attempt to persuade the user to seek medical attention before it becomes worse. Once a medical emergency is detected, the device alerts surrounding people and paramedics of the emergency and distributes medical and personal information different for surrounding people and paramedics. This includes medical conditions, health insurance information, next of kin, etc. This information can be uploaded to the device's onboard memory drive and can share the information or steps to reach the information, through an onboard speaker system, Bluetooth pairing, and near-filled communication (NFC) to which paramedics have special access.
